Preview WEC | Can Ferrari beat home favourite Toyota at Fuji?

No Formula 1 this weekend, but racing fans can certainly indulge themselves next weekend. The sixth round in the World Endurance Championship(WEC) is scheduled at the Fuji circuit in Japan. With only one race to go after this (in Bahrain), the tension in the title race is rising to a boiling point: will Toyota prolong the title again in the coming weeks or will Ferrari surprise, as the Italians already did by winning the 24 Hours of Le Mans?
